[. . . ] When drilling holes in the chassis for installation, take precautions so as not to contact, damage or obstruct pipes, fuel lines, tanks or electrical wiring. Bolts or nuts used for the brake or steering systems (or any other safety-related system), or tanks should NEVER be used for installations or ground connections. Using such parts could disable control of the vehicle and cause fire etc. Return it to your authorized Alpine dealer or the nearest Alpine Service Center for repairing. [. . . ] NOTE: To securely connect the ground lead, use an already installed screw on the metal part of the vehicle (marked (})). Be sure this is a good ground by checking continuity to the battery (­) terminal. Attach the terminal covers (supplied) after connections and confirmation of correct operation. How to attach the terminal covers: Attach the left and right terminal covers using the supplied M3 screws, as shown in the figure below. 1 Right terminal cover 2 Left terminal cover 3 Screws (M3) NOTE: Do not lift or carry the unit by the attached terminal covers. Before making connections, be sure to turn the power off to all audio components. Connect the yellow battery lead from the amp directly to the positive (+) terminal of the vehicle's battery. Locate the unit and route the leads at least 10 cm (3-15/16") away from the car harness. ⷠKeep the battery power leads as far away from other leads as possible. ⷠConnect the ground lead securely to a bare metal spot (remove any paint or grease if necessary) of the car chassis. ⷠIf you add an optional noise suppressor, connect it as far away from the unit as possible. Your Alpine dealer carries various noise suppressors, contact them for further information. ⷠYour Alpine dealer knows best about noise prevention measures so consult your dealer for further information. Important This unit cannot be turned on or operated unless the Ai-NET compatible head unit (IVA-D310R or DVA9860R, etc. Do not use the speaker (­) terminals as a common lead between the left and right channels. 3 Battery Lead (Yellow) (Sold Separately) Be sure to add a 40 amp fuse (or two 20A fuses in parallel) as close as possible to the battery's positive (+) terminal. This fuse will protect your vehicle's electrical system in case of a short circuit. NOTE: Before connecting the lead, install a ring termination at the end of the lead, as illustrated. 4 Ground Lead (Black) (Sold Separately) Connect this lead securely to a clean, bare metal spot on the vehicle's chassis. Verify this point to be a true ground by checking for continuity between that point and the negative (­) terminal of the vehicle's battery.
